Where is carbon located on our planet, and how are these carbon reservoirs different from each other?
sladkih [1.3K]

Answer: Most carbon is stored in rocks and sediments, while the rest is stored in the ocean, atmosphere, and living organisms. These are the reservoirs, or sinks, through which carbon cycles. The ocean is a giant carbon sink that absorbs carbon.

How are primary producers important to the alligator's energy supply
kozerog [31]

Primary producers make their own food for example plants. As you go into the upper levels of the food chain the energy gets distributed to each level, but they lose some of their energy. Without primary producers alligators will not be able to obtain the energy they need for themselves to survive.
